Animal Farm has some highly-specific details about its setting, although it is vague in many ways, befitting its original designation as a fairy tale. It is relatively easy to envisage the farmhouse and the landscape, but somewhat more difficult to determine the time, or the number of years over which the events occur. This adds to the impression that the allegory applies to repeated events over the past as well as those which might take place in future.
